Family mediation is a voluntary process where an impartial mediator helps family members reach agreements on various issues such as custody, support, and property division. This method prioritizes open communication and collaborative problem solving to resolve conflicts outside the courtroom. Family mediation involves a neutral third party who assists family members in negotiating and settling disagreements amicably. The mediator promotes understanding and helps clarify legal rights and responsibilities without imposing decisions. It is particularly useful in situations involving divorce, child custody, or division of assets. The goal is to empower families to find their own solutions in a supportive environment.
Essential elements of family mediation include confidentiality, voluntary participation, and a focus on future-oriented solutions. The process typically involves joint and separate sessions where concerns are expressed openly, and compromises are explored. The mediator guides discussions, identifies common ground, and drafts agreements for approval by all parties. This framework encourages respectful negotiation and helps reduce conflict between family members.

Families in Holly Springs considering dispute resolution often weigh mediation against traditional court litigation. Mediation offers a cooperative environment focused on finding common ground, while litigation can be adversarial and prolonged. Choosing mediation typically results in faster resolutions, lower costs, and greater flexibility tailored to the family’s needs. However, some situations may require court involvement, especially where urgent protective measures are needed.
When both parties are open to communication and compromise, mediation alone can efficiently resolve disputes without escalating to litigation. This approach preserves relationships and reduces stress.
Disagreements involving clear-cut matters, such as property division or visitation schedules, may be resolved effectively through mediation without the need for a court hearing.
In cases where parties exhibit hostility or unwillingness to negotiate, comprehensive legal support including litigation may be necessary to protect client interests.
Disputes involving significant financial assets, allegations of abuse, or complex custody matters often require the expertise of attorneys throughout mediation and potential court proceedings.

Mediation is commonly used during divorce proceedings, child custody disputes, visitation scheduling, and division of assets when parties seek an amicable resolution without prolonged litigation.
Parents negotiating custody arrangements and visitation schedules often use mediation to find fair terms that prioritize children’s best interests.
Mediation helps parties agree on dividing property and financial assets equitably, avoiding contentious court battles.
When determining spousal support or alimony, mediation can facilitate agreements based on financial realities and individual needs respectfully.

Yes, mediation sessions are confidential. Information disclosed during mediation cannot typically be used as evidence in court if the mediation does not lead to an agreement. This confidentiality promotes honest conversation and creates a safe space for all parties to express their concerns freely.
If mediation fails to produce an agreement, parties may choose to pursue traditional litigation or explore other dispute resolution methods. Participation in mediation does not waive any legal rights. Our firm supports clients through both mediation and, if necessary, court proceedings to ensure their interests are fully represented.
The duration can vary depending on the complexity of the issues and willingness of the parties to cooperate. Many mediations conclude within a few sessions over several weeks.
